Ingredients for Food Recipes With Red Wine
- 1 bottle of Cabernet Sauvignon (750ml)
- 2 lbs beef tenderloin, trimmed
- 2 tbsp olive oil
- 1 large onion, chopped
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tbsp tomato paste
- 1 cup beef broth
- 1 tsp dried thyme
- 1/2 tsp dried rosemary
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 1 lb baby potatoes, halved
- 1 cup fresh mushrooms, sliced

Step-by-Step Preparation of Food Recipes With Red Wine
-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C).
- Season the beef tenderloin generously with salt and pepper.
- Heat olive oil in a large oven-safe skillet over medium-high heat.
- Sear the beef tenderloin on all sides until browned.
- Add the chopped onion and minced garlic to the skillet and cook until softened.
- Stir in the tomato paste and cook for 1 minute more.
- Pour in the red wine and bring to a simmer.
- Add the beef broth, thyme, and rosemary.
- Transfer the skillet to the preheated oven and cook for 1 hour, or until the beef is cooked through.
- Add the potatoes and mushrooms to the skillet during the last 30 minutes of cooking.
Tips and Troubleshooting, Food Recipes With Red Wine
If the sauce becomes too thick, add a little more beef broth. Ensure the beef is cooked to your desired doneness.

What are some basic guidelines for pairing red wine with food?
Consider the food’s ingredients, flavors, and overall complexity. A lighter red wine, like Pinot Noir, often complements delicate dishes, while bolder reds, like Cabernet Sauvignon, pair well with richer, more robust meals. Think about the acidity, tannins, and body of the wine, and how they relate to the food’s characteristics.
How can I tell if a red wine is a good choice for a particular dish?
Pay attention to the wine’s flavor profile. If the dish features strong flavors, a bolder red wine can complement them effectively. Conversely, a more delicate dish may be best paired with a lighter-bodied red wine. Also consider the dish’s cooking method. A dish with a longer cooking time may benefit from a wine with more tannins.
Are there any specific red wine pairings for vegetarian dishes?
Absolutely! While red wine is often associated with meat dishes, certain red wines can also complement vegetarian cuisine. Pinot Noir, with its subtle fruit flavors, is a good choice for dishes featuring herbs and vegetables. Look for lighter-bodied reds that won’t overpower the flavors of the dish.
